uncensored Sandra de los Santos .- The 12.8 percent of the population between 12 and 17 years in Chiapas do not study or work according to the report 2010 Children's Account in Mexico. Children account in Mexico is an information system for monitoring children's rights in the country. The information is obtained from official data provided by various departments as well as National Institute of Statistics and Geography (INEGI).
Nationally there are a million 263 000 723 adolescents between 12 and 17 who did not attend school and do not work, this translates into 9.4 percent of the population in this age range. In Chiapas the absolute number is 83 000 902 children between 12 and 17 years of age who are neither studying nor working the percentage exceeds the national average being 12.8 percent.
should be noted that according to the latest survey on discrimination in Mexico conducted by the National Council to Prevent and Eliminate Discrimination (Conapred) the main problem faced by young people is the lack of employment, also plays an important lack of access to higher education.
Chiapas is among the states with the lowest rate of absorption in the middle and upper level, although in recent years has been overcoming their backwardness, according to information from the last census of population and housing INEGI. Different civil organizations working for child rights have called on the different levels of government adequate public policies that enable adolescents and young people joining the school and the work force when they have finished their studies. Edgar's case "N", nicknamed The PONCHISE, whose criminal activity began at 10 years of age as a mule or courier Beltran Leyva cartel in Morelos, is not unique or new. It is estimated that criminal organizations have recruited at least 35 000 children aged between 12 and 17 years, which have taken advantage of their poverty and vulnerability. "They are the cannon fodder of organized crime," says M Weekly President of the Commission on Citizenship of the Chamber of Deputies, Arturo Santana. "The failed strategy against organized crime and lack of public policies care and support to children, have allowed the drug cartels operate with impunity as recruiters of thousands of child victims of poverty and family breakdown, and willing to do anything to make money or get a sense of belonging or identity providing criminal gangs, "he stresses. Mexico City (CIMAC) .- In 2009 more than half the children in Mexico was in asset poverty (62.2 percent) and one in four children (28 percent) did not have enough income to meet their food requirements, according to reports from the Mexico office of the United Nations Fund for Children.
In that year, according to INEGI, 30.9 million children between 0 and 14 years residing in the country, which means that more than 19 million children living in asset poverty, ie without a per capita income sufficient to meet housing needs, clothing, footwear and transport.
In the case of indigenous girls, these problems are exacerbated, since it persists triple discrimination for being a minor, belong to an ethnic group and being poor. This situation leaves them "more vulnerable than children," says UN agency. Full story here
. Mexico City (CIMAC) .- In recent years it has increased to nearly 50 percent of girls migration (Mexico and other countries) toward United States, according to the National Survey of Employment and Occupation (ENOE), National Institute of Statistics and Geography.
According to the same survey during the 2006-2008 approximately 198 thousand children under 15 years living in Mexico went to live abroad, representing eight percent of the total registered migrants period.
"Pretty close to half of international migrants accounted for less than 15 years in the period were girls, ie 47 out of 100" sets the INEGI. Full story here
